Short term trading and other adventures in patience and discipline. October 8, 2011. NASDAQ: BIDU trade post mortem. I made a mistake in my trading today, and wanted to talk about it here. As mentioned this morning. I went long NASDAQ: BIDU in hopes of a swing trade. Ideally, here’s how I think my trade should have been executed:. 1) Long BIDU 117.4 (green arrow). 2) Sell 1/4 BIDU @118. 3) Buy 1/4 BIDU 116. 4) Sell 1/4 BIDU 119, raise stop to 115 (blue arrow). 5) Sell 1/4 BIDU 120.8, raise stop to b/e.

Short term trading and other adventures in patience and discipline. October 15, 2011. Here is a chart which captures my trades made in Baidu (NASDAQ: BIDU) yesterday. The rationale for making this trade was simple:. A) Baidu is in an uptrend. B) There was an unfilled gap from last week. C) Google (NASDAQ: GOOG) reported earnings above expectations, and was widely expected to gap up. Short term trading and other adventures in patience and discipline. October 18, 2011. Despite having a trading plan for Baidu (NASDAQ: BIDU), I sold and exited my position for the following reasons:. 8211; market context: Trend day to mark the first day of a sell off / pullback. 8211; Baidu gapped down and could not recover above yesterday’s open. 8211; inability to reach 139, or even Friday’s hi. 8211; Baidu is overbought on the daily chart. I will look to buy back between the gap fill (133) and 131.
